首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用带格式的单元格导出到Excel?

使用带格式的单元格导出到Excel可以通过以下几个步骤完成:

  1. 导入相关的库或模块: 首先,你可以使用一些开源的库或模块来实现这个功能,如openpyxl、xlwt、pandas等。具体选择哪个库取决于你的项目需求和个人偏好。
  2. 创建Excel文件和工作表: 使用所选库或模块的相关方法,你可以创建一个新的Excel文件并添加一个工作表。
  3. 设置单元格格式: 对于需要特定格式的单元格,你可以使用相应的方法来设置格式,如设置字体、字号、颜色、对齐方式等。每个库或模块都有自己的方法和属性来实现这些操作,你可以参考其官方文档或示例代码。
  4. 填充数据: 将你想要导出的数据填充到Excel文件的相应单元格中。可以使用库或模块提供的方法来写入数据。
  5. 导出Excel文件: 使用库或模块的保存方法将Excel文件保存到指定的路径。可以选择保存为不同的Excel格式,如.xls或.xlsx。

以下是一个示例代码(使用openpyxl库)来演示如何使用带格式的单元格导出到Excel:

代码语言:txt
复制
import openpyxl
from openpyxl.styles import Font, Alignment

# 创建新的Excel文件和工作表
workbook = openpyxl.Workbook()
sheet = workbook.active

# 设置单元格格式
bold_font = Font(bold=True, size=12)
center_alignment = Alignment(horizontal='center', vertical='center')

# 填充数据
data = [
    ['Name', 'Age', 'Country'],
    ['John', 25, 'USA'],
    ['Emma', 30, 'Canada'],
    ['Li', 28, 'China']
]

for row in data:
    sheet.append(row)

# 设置特定单元格的格式
for cell in sheet[1]:
    cell.font = bold_font
    cell.alignment = center_alignment

# 保存Excel文件
workbook.save('output.xlsx')

在这个示例中,我们使用openpyxl库创建了一个新的Excel文件并添加了一个工作表。然后,我们设置了第一行的字体为粗体并居中对齐。最后,我们填充了一些数据,并将文件保存为output.xlsx。

请注意,这只是一个简单的示例,你可以根据自己的需求进一步扩展和定制导出功能。

对于腾讯云的相关产品和链接,我们不提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商,但你可以参考腾讯云的官方文档和产品介绍来了解他们提供的云计算解决方案和相关产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券